What is All Star Slots?

All Star Slots is a download-based casino software game licensed by Realtime Gaming (RTG) and distributed by various RTG-powerd casio websites.

Overview

All Star Slots is a program developed by RealTimeGaming Software. The most used version is 11.2.0, with over 98% of all installations currently using this version. Upon installation, it defines an auto-start registry entry which allows the program run on each boot for the user which installed it. A scheduled task is added to Windows Task Scheduler in order to launch the program at various scheduled times (the schedule varies depending on the version). The software installer includes 27 files and is usually about 265.06 MB (277,932,600 bytes). In comparison to the total number of users, most PCs are running the OS Windows 7 (SP1) as well as Windows Vista (SP2). While about 89% of users of All Star Slots come from the United States, it is also popular in Australia and Spain.

How do I remove All Star Slots?

You can uninstall All Star Slots from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
  1. On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
    •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
  2. When you find the program All Star Slots, click it, and then do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
    •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
  3.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ove All Star Slots.

About RealTimeGaming Software

Realtime Gaming is an online casino company developing download casino software, licensed by operators running their own branded casino sites.
